Ruined croft house, 5-6 Hacklet (Hacleit), in 1995
Looking northeast across upper Loch Chearabhaigh (a sea loch) towards the scattered township of Kilerivagh. According to local information from Mary Harman in 2018, the house is still there with the mid gable with chimney standing, but the roof is entirely gone. The windows are still clear, and the winnowing hole in the barn at the left hand side of the picture is still there. The telegraph pole behind the house, being redundant is no longer there. The building probably dates from the 19th century and is Category B listed [http://portal.historicenvironment.scot/designation/LB18754]. It also appears on the Buildings at Risk Register [https://www.buildingsatrisk.org.uk/search/keyword/hacklet/event_id/898243/building_name/5-6-hacklet].

Ruined croft house, Haclait, Beinn na Faoghla/Benbecula
The condition of the croft house has deteriorated significantly in the 30 years since Richard's photo was taken: Image Due to the loss of any remains of its thatched roof, the house lost its listed status in 2021.
